How Do You Turn Fresh Water Into Sea Water?
You can turn fresh water into sea water by adding salt. The process is straightforward and involves dissolving a specific amount of salt in a measured quantity of fresh water.
This method outlines the basic process, using readily available materials:
-
Measure the salt: Begin by weighing out a precise amount of salt. For example, you could weigh 35 grams of common table salt (sodium chloride).
-
Dissolve the salt: Add the measured salt to a container, such as a beaker. Then, add fresh water to the container until the total mass of the solution reaches 1000 grams.
-
Mix thoroughly: Stir the mixture using a stirring rod until all the salt is completely dissolved. The resulting solution will have a salinity similar to seawater, though the exact composition may differ depending on the type of salt used.
Considerations for Different Applications:
While the above method provides a basic understanding, the specific approach will vary based on your application:
-
Aquarium conversion: If converting a freshwater aquarium to a saltwater aquarium (as mentioned in several references, including Reef Builders, The Spruce Pets, and a YouTube video titled "Freshwater to Saltwater Conversion How To!"), you'll need to carefully manage the salinity increase to avoid harming any existing aquatic life. Gradual introduction of salt is crucial. A slow process, monitored with a hydrometer, ensures the health of the inhabitants.
-
Scientific experiments: For scientific purposes, accurate measurements and high-purity salt are essential. You may need specialized equipment and calculations depending on the experiment's requirements.
